All is calm, All is White

Its very rare that I use white on white in my projects, but I am pleased with the result. The inspiration started at The Funkie Junkie 12 Tags of Christmas Challenge. I am so hoping that I can finish this challenge, but as the big day gets nearer the days get busier!


I took inspiration from Linda's tag in the form or the three small tags, the snowflakes and flowers. 
First I embossed the background with a snowflake embossing folder and my Sizzix machine. Then I applied Perfect Medium and WOW! Embossing Powder  - Hologram Sparkle. The tags were cut with a die and the snowflakes punched from silver mirri card. The letters are Thickers which I have had in my stash for some time! I mounted the tags onto the background with foam pads. The flower embellishment was made from the same embossed card stock and vellum, cut with the Tattered Floral Die. I finished the card off by mounting it onto grey card and then Silver Centura Pearl.  So now its onto stage 8 of the challenge!
